RedMagic relaunching gaming smartphone globally with new version

The RedMagic 11 Air launched globally at the end of January. Following on from the RedMagic 11 Pro (curr. $799 on Amazon), the RedMagic 11 Air was initially available in Phantom and Prism finishes. However, RedMagic has now confirmed that a third option is on its way.
This new release only represents a visual refresh of the RedMagic 11 Air, though. Thus, the device will still feature a Snapdragon 8 Elite chipset and a 7,000 mAh battery, as well as a 6.85-inch AMOLED display that combines a 144 Hz refresh rate with under-panel camera technology. As far as we can tell, 'Trace' merely adds orange accents to the Prism finish in which the device was previously available.
Specifically, RedMagic has included splashes of orange around each camera lens, one of the device's physical hardware buttons and across its back panel. For some reason, Trace will not be available with the RedMagic 11 Air's base 12 GB RAM and 256 GB storage configuration. Instead, RedMagic only plans to offer the new release with 16 GB of RAM and 512 GB of storage. Consequently, the Trace version will cost €599 in the Eurozone, £529 in the UK and $599 in the US. Pre-orders will open globally on March 30.
